Asahi Linux 适配苹果 Mac 最新进度:M3 支持度接近 M1 初始水平
It之家1天前

IT之家 4 月 26 日消息,Asahi Linux 项目团队公布最新进度报告,重点介绍了围绕 Linux 7.0 内核周期的上游化工作以及下游 Asahi Linux 代码库的最新补充。报告显示,在 Apple M3 芯片 Mac 上运行 Linux 的支持已取得实质性突破,目前已达到与当初 Asahi Linux 在 M1 平台上首次推出 Alpha 版本时的品质大致相当的水平。同时,项目团队还推出了近两年来的首个 Asahi 安装器更新版本。由于安装器本身的复杂性以及生成新发行版本构建所涉及的诸多流程,新版 Asahi 安装器的发布间隔已接近两年。此次推出的 Asahi Installer 0.8 更新了内置的 m1n1 第一阶段二进制文件至 1.5.2 版本,新增了 Mac Pro 支持,并引入了固件更新模式。新的固件更新路径现已支持环境光传感器,用户可从 macOS 恢复环境重新运行安装器并选择固件升级选项,无需手动编辑 EFI 系统分区即可刷新供应商固件包。在 M3 芯片支持方面,Asahi Linux 开发者持续在下游内核中推进硬件启用工作。报告显示,M3 设备的 PCIe、MacBook 键盘与触控板、基于 SMC 的实时时钟与重启控制器,以及 NVMe 控制器均已获得支持。开发者还修复了蓝牙相关问题,增加了更多音频 quirks,并持续致力于降低苹果 M 系列芯片运行 Linux 时的空闲功耗。Asahi Linux 的 M3 支持工作目前仍主要停留在下游内核中,距离合入主线 Linux 内核还需要一段时间。与此同时,项目在电源管理上也获得突破 —— 为 Pro、Max 和 Ultra 类 Apple Silicon 系统新增了电源管理处理器驱动。开发者称,此次更新使一台 14 英寸 M1 Pro MacBook Pro 的空闲功耗降低约 0.5W(IT之家注:降幅约 20%),但目前尚未默认启用该功能,需在所有支持的机型上完成验证和上游集成后才能开启。显示方面,项目组已确定 Apple 的 DCP 固件启用可变刷新率的方式,并在外部 VRR 显示器和 MacBook Pro 的 ProMotion 面板上进行了测试,计划在相关代码合并后提供强制启用 VRR 的内核模块选项。音频方面,Linux 7.1 内核已合并新的 ASoC 总线保持 API,取代了原有的 Apple 专用方案,CS42L84 耳机接口现支持 44.1、88.2、176.4 和 192 kHz 等更多采样率。其报告还预告了 Fedora Asahi Remix 44 的更新情况,预计该版本将在 4 月 28 日与 Fedora Linux 44 同步发布。新版安装将使用 Plasma Setup 而非 Calamares,新安装将采用 Plasma Login Manager 取代 SDDM,已升级系统将保留当前配置。此外,Fedora Asahi Remix 44 将移除 Asahi 自带的 Mesa 和 virglrenderer 软件包,用户将过渡到上游 Fedora 版本,进一步减少 Apple Silicon 专属软件包的分叉。相关阅读:《消息称微软 Azure Linux 将重新基于 Fedora 构建,应用 x86_64-v3 微架构提升性能》《Fedora 44 正式版 4 月 28 日发布,集成多项重要技术更新》